Reject ambiguous resource paths with inner ".." to prevent silent misresolution (#6087)
* Reject paths with inner '..' in FileLoader.New to prevent silent misresolution * Refactor hasInnerDotDot to two-phase loop eliminating mutable state * Narrow check to embedded '..' segments to allow legitimate winding paths * Fix gofmt alignment and trailing whitespace in new test functions * Fix pre-existing lint errors in fileloader_test.go

// hasAmbiguousPathSegment reports whether path contains a segment with ".."
|
||||||
|
// embedded in it (not ".." itself). This pattern results from YAML indentation
|
||||||
|
// errors where two list entries merge into one scalar, e.g.:
|
||||||
|
//
|
||||||
|
// resources:
|
||||||
|
// - ../../base
|
||||||
|
// - ../../shared/prod
|
||||||
|
//
|
||||||
|
// YAML parses this as "../../base - ../../shared/prod", producing segment
|
||||||
|
// "base - .." which filepath.Clean absorbs, silently resolving to an
|
||||||
|
// unintended directory.
|
||||||
|
func hasAmbiguousPathSegment(path string) bool {
|
||||||
|
for _, part := range strings.Split(filepath.ToSlash(path), "/") {
|
||||||
|
if part != "" && part != "." && part != ".." && strings.Contains(part, "..") {
|
||||||
|
return true
|
||||||
|
}
|
||||||
|
}
|
||||||
|
return false
|
||||||
|
}
